1 definition by CumbreVieja

Top Definition
A combative employed by bicycle cops. You take an unmanned bicycle and ram it into your opponent.
The park ranger ghost ridered the purse snatcher after he decided to fight instead of surrender.
#bike strikes #barrier/herding #bike drop #bike throw #power slide take down
by CumbreVieja February 12, 2013
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.